My list to start the ball rolling
1- Conti Road Attack tyres. Massive improvement on the OE Dunlops. http://www.conti-bike.co.uk/default.asp?spid=3 2- A decent replacement end can, mines a Scorpion and it sounds brill. http://www.scorpion-exhausts.com/Bikes/index.php 3- Scottoiler. Who needs shaft drive. Fit and forget. http://www.scottoiler.com/ 4- Fender extender for the front mudguard. Keep the rain off that front sparky plug. Mines a Pyramid. http://www.pyramid-plastics.co.uk/ca...products_id=98 5- Seat cowl. Improves the looks no end. Standard Suzuki accessory 6- Rear Hugger. Keeps the crap off the subframe which in turn keeps the rust at bay. http://skidmarx.co.uk/section/mudgua...rs/suzuki.html 7- Fender eliminator for the rear (tail tidy). Again to just improve looks. http://stores.ebay.co.uk/EVOTECH-PER...MPLEPAGEQQtZkm 8- K&N air filter. Safe price as Suzuki item but washable. http://www.knfilters.co.uk/ 9- Braided Brake lines. No particular make, but maybe HEL. http://www.h-e-l.co.uk/ John
